Emma Creed skillfully weaves the final part of this six-book series through Reaching Limits- Part 2 of Cole and Savannah’s story, and book six of the Corrupt Cowboys series. Cole, the Carson brother with the darkest story yet, continues to aggravate us and bring us to tears throughout the remainder of his tale. Savannah continues to the be the feisty, stubborn heroine that we’ve come to know and love. And the two of them complement each other perfectly.
The ongoing feud with the Mason family, along with some new twists and tricks, leaves us flipping through pages faster than a winning run in a calf-roping contest. I could NOT put this one down until I knew how EVERYTHING was going to pan out. The emotional toll that this relationship has taken on me is fantastic- throw in the angst and the secrets and everything you could hope for, this conclusion is chef’s kiss. The steam…. Good Lord the steam…. Savannah and Cole are as hot as ever and, as we all know, when you’re angry with each other, well, it’s always an inferno that follows.
Family is everything, and I love how the Carson family stays true to that- in every sense of the word- with the Carson Ranch, as well as the Dirty Souls. “Whatever it takes.” Emma has successfully tied all these pieces together between the two series and it makes you really feel like this ranch in Montana is another safe haven- another home.
